From b1e142e96dd2a8be8fd802ef4ac83f91f7359c59 Mon Sep 17 00:00:00 2001 From: Florian Bruhin Date: Thu, 5 Dec 2019 23:45:35 +0100 Subject: travis: Fix/blacklist failing environments --- .travis.yml | 25 +++++++++++++++++-------- 1 file changed, 17 insertions(+), 8 deletions(-) diff --git a/.travis.yml b/.travis.yml index 50f431626..b66d7c5d9 100644 --- a/.travis.yml +++ b/.travis.yml @@ -6,6 +6,12 @@ os: linux matrix: fast_finish: true + allow_failures: + # Python 3.8 issues (fixed on master) + - env: DOCKER=archlinux + services: docker + # mypy issues (fixed on master) + - env: TESTENV=mypy include: ### Archlinux QtWebKit - env: DOCKER=archlinux @@ -51,16 +57,19 @@ matrix: packages: - libxkbcommon-x11-0 - ### macOS sierra + ### macOS Mojave (10.14) + - os: osx + env: TESTENV=py37-pyqt513 OSX=mojave + osx_image: xcode11.2 + language: generic + python: 3.7 + + ### macOS High Sierra (10.13) - os: osx - env: TESTENV=py37-pyqt513 OSX=sierra - osx_image: xcode9.2 + env: TESTENV=py37-pyqt513 OSX=highsierra + osx_image: xcode10.1 language: generic - ### macOS yosemite - # https://github.com/qutebrowser/qutebrowser/issues/2013 - # - os: osx - # env: TESTENV=py35 OSX=yosemite - # osx_image: xcode6.4 + python: 3.7 ### pylint/flake8/mypy - env: TESTENV=pylint -- cgit v1.2.3-54-g00ecf